Meanwhile, the Asian Champions League sees 12 clubs vying for the final seven spots in the knockout stage, with Saudi Arabian and Japanese teams dominating the competition. Reigning champions Al-Ain have already been eliminated, while clubs like Al-Hilal and Al-Nassr have advanced. The stakes are high as teams like Shanghai Port and Pohang Steelers aim for critical victories to secure their places in the next round.
